Cappagh Lodge Td , Sixmilebridge , Co. Clare
Proposed development
to fill the existing poor quality agricultural land with stone and soil in order to raise the level of the ground, including all ancillary site works. An Appropriate Assessment Screening Report and Natura Impact Statement have been prepared and included with the application
What happens next
Permission was refused on 31 Mar 2026. The applicant may appeal within four weeks of the decision.
